Transaction 77f248943b131c07290bc4af459e99c6570cc4cd677c576d5245121962dd4684
1 Input
1 Output
-
77f248943b131c07290bc4af459e99c6570cc4cd677c576d5245121962dd4684:0
- value
- 2357861
- script pubkey
- OP_0 OP_PUSHBYTES_20 9711d5688d75c0441a9000cb6a49b45a00ecf376
- address
- bc1qjuga26ydwhqygx5sqr9k5jd5tgqweumkn7l3tx